Is The Revenue Intelligence Investigation Into The Rs 50,000 Crore Over-Invoicing Scam Heading Towards A Judicial Logjam?

By PARANJOY GUHA THAKURTA | 24 March 2018 The finance ministry has said that it is keen on pursuing the cases arising from the DRI investigation into the over-invoicing scam, but there is a view that deliberate attempts are being made to stymie the prosecution process. Power Foods for the Brain | Neal Barnard

Power Foods for the Brain Dr. Barnard has led numerous research studies investigating the effects of diet on diabetes, body weight, and chronic pain, including a groundbreaking study of dietary interventions in type 2 diabetes, funded by the National Institutes of Health. Dr. Barnard has authored over 70 scientific publications as well as 17 books.
